About the series
From 1963 to 1965, Marvel's Strange Tales ran for seven issues under the Horwitz imprint, offering a compact anthology of eerie, supernatural short stories. Writers Stan Lee and Larry Lieber, alongside artists Jack Kirby and Maurice Bramley, shaped its modest but memorable run, blending classic horror twists with the nascent Marvel style. Though brief, the series stands as a snapshot of early-1960s genre experimentation, showcasing the creative energy that would soon redefine comics.
